Efficacy of Saroglitazar in patients with Metabolic Dysfunction Associated Steatotic Liver Disease With Associated Etiology of Steatotic Liver Disease

研究概览

简要总结

Saroglitazar may have beneficial role in NAFLD with significant fibrosis. No studies  have analyzed the role of saroglitazar in MASLD with associated etiology  . We will conduct this study in order to study efficacy of saroglitazar in patients with Met ALD and MASLD with associated etiologies. Treatment response will be compared between MASLD and MASLD with associated etiologies. We will compare with response of saroglitazar in patients with pure MASLD and multiple etiology SLD.  We will also assess the role of saroglitazar in improvement of fibrosis and steatosis in patients with MASLD with associated etiology.

入选标准

  • Patients with MASLD: defined by the presence of hepatic steatosis on ultrasound or using controlled attenuation parameters (CAP) (of Fibroscan) together with the presence of at least one of five cardiometabolic criteria .
  • 2.Patients of MASLD with moderate amount of alcohol intake (Met ALD) 3.Patients of MASLD with hepatitis C infection 4.Patients of MASLD with HBV infection 5.Patients of MASLD taking one of the steatogenic drugs
  • Patients in all above categories having with liver stiffness measurement (LSM) on VCTE (Fibroscan) of more than 8kPa and less than 13.6 kPa.

排除标准

  • 1.Patients of compensated or decompensated cirrhosis 2.Patients with HCC or any other malignancy 3.Patients already on Vitamin E, Saroglitazar or pioglitazone 4.Pregnancy/Lactation and those non pregnant female patients recruited in the study who will conceive during the study period will be excluded from the study.
  • 5.Patients who are too sick to conduct the protocol.
  • 6.Patients with significant ethanol intake (more than 60 g/ day and 50g/day in males and females respectively).

结局指标

主要结局

Improvement in hepatic steatosis as evidenced by CAP at 6 months in patients with MASLD with/without associated etiology

时间窗: Assessment will be done at baseline, 3 months and 6 months

次要结局

  • Comparison of improvement in hepatic steatosis as evidenced by CAP at 6 months in patients with MASLD and MASLD with associated etiology of SLD(Improvement in fibrosis as evidenced by LSM, APRI, FIB-4, AGILE-3+, AGILE 4 at 6 months in MASLD with associated etiology)
